Update etl diagram for poi layer (#1297)

Add the missing `osm_poi_stop_centroid` and `osm_poi_stop_rank` materialized views.
This commit is contained in:
zstadler 2021-11-10 20:49:18 +02:00 committed by GitHub
parent ebeafc65fa
commit 1be440404b
No known key found for this signature in database
GPG Key ID: 4AEE18F83AFDEB23
3 changed files with 4 additions and 0 deletions

Binary file not shown.

Before

Width:  |  Height:  |  Size: 30 KiB

After

Width:  |  Height:  |  Size: 54 KiB

View File

@ -1,3 +1,4 @@
-- etldoc: osm_poi_point -> osm_poi_stop_centroid
DROP MATERIALIZED VIEW IF EXISTS osm_poi_stop_centroid CASCADE; DROP MATERIALIZED VIEW IF EXISTS osm_poi_stop_centroid CASCADE;
CREATE MATERIALIZED VIEW osm_poi_stop_centroid AS CREATE MATERIALIZED VIEW osm_poi_stop_centroid AS
( (
@ -11,6 +12,8 @@ GROUP BY uic_ref
HAVING count(*) > 1 HAVING count(*) > 1
) /* DELAY_MATERIALIZED_VIEW_CREATION */; ) /* DELAY_MATERIALIZED_VIEW_CREATION */;
-- etldoc: osm_poi_stop_centroid -> osm_poi_stop_rank
-- etldoc: osm_poi_point -> osm_poi_stop_rank
DROP MATERIALIZED VIEW IF EXISTS osm_poi_stop_rank CASCADE; DROP MATERIALIZED VIEW IF EXISTS osm_poi_stop_rank CASCADE;
CREATE MATERIALIZED VIEW osm_poi_stop_rank AS CREATE MATERIALIZED VIEW osm_poi_stop_rank AS
( (

View File

@ -25,6 +25,7 @@ $$ LANGUAGE plpgsql;
SELECT update_osm_poi_point(); SELECT update_osm_poi_point();
-- etldoc: osm_poi_stop_rank -> osm_poi_point
CREATE OR REPLACE FUNCTION update_osm_poi_point_agg() RETURNS void AS CREATE OR REPLACE FUNCTION update_osm_poi_point_agg() RETURNS void AS
$$ $$
BEGIN BEGIN